GRTC Pulse plan: Loss of parking spaces along route is concern

RICHMOND, Va. (WRIC) — Dozens of people crammed inside the University of Richmond’s downtown building to attend a public meeting on the GRTC Pulse (Bus Rapid Transit) Monday.

The GRTC Pulse is being touted to eventually serve a 7.6 mile route through the high-density and high ridership areas along Broad Street.

“Right now it will take you almost on this stretch if you ride local buses a little more than an hour to get to one end to the other, once BRT is operational it will be about 30-minutes. So, imagine getting a little over an hour you’re getting half of your trip back,” said GRTC Public Relations Manager Carrie Rose Pace.

The original plan called for doing away with more than 700 parking spaces in downtown Richmond, but now a revised plan will save more than 400-spaces.

Losing parking spaces was a huge concern for Zoe Anne Greene who is a member of the Museum District Association as well as the Coalition for Smart Transit.

“The main concerns with parking are the loss of parking on Broad Street and the overflow parking from the loss of parking on Broad Street and the parking at the different stations,” said Greene, who is worried that  taking away spaces will force people to park in already congested neighborhoods.

However, people have said they are relieved that hundreds of parking spaces will be spared.

“A lot of people are coming out and getting involved which is good because this plan is clearly better than the one we saw in May so hopefully public input will continue to make it better,” said Richmond City Councilman Jonathan Baliles.

Even Greene said the new plan is an improvement.

“It’s gotten better it’s gotten a lot better but I still think there’s still a way to go,” said Green.
